I think we need to talk more about the belief that Gojo has his Infinity up 24/7...or more like the fact that I think we misunderstand what kind if barrier Infinity actually is.
In the manga, from what I remember, when Gojo describes being able to have it 'on' constantly he describes it as analyzing incoming objects and people and stopping anything harmful/lethal. NOT that he has a constant barrier over his skin to prevent contact.
I mean he manually activates Infinity when Utahime throws her tea at him. So that means the tea and cup wouldn't be auto-blocked because it wasn't considered a threat(or maybe to prevent having to constantly work around his CT when drinking/eating) or that he has Utahime and things she touches on a 'safe' list that Infinity doesn't properly register as a threat.
When Yuuji asks Gojo to bring down his Infinity for back slaps, that implies that it's not usually up when Yuuji touches him/he doesnt usually encounter it when touching Gojo(and my boi is physically affectionate with Gojo from what the manga and anime shows).
Yuuta mentions Infinity being ungodly finicky when he's fighting Sukuna and I remember him mentioning having to anaylze/see all of the attacks coming at him. This implies that Infinity is not an actual 'field' but that it 'targets' things that are trying to reach the CT user.
What makes Gojo so 'untouchable' isn't a barrier field, but rather an internal program that is constantly analyzing things in his vicinity and classifying them as 'threat' and 'non-threat'. Which makes sense why he has to have RCT running all the time as I assume this is nearly CONSTANTLY frying his CPU.
But it kinda scuttles the whole 'he doesn't let people touch him' thing, which, very untrue? My man is slinging arms around shoulder, hugging Yuuji and generally poking and pal'ing around with people constantly.
It DOES however lend itself to Gojo being hypervigilant(Oh? PTSD, I know her), and a bit paranoid under his careless exterior.
